We have all collected family research, memorabilia and heirlooms over the years.  But will our family want to continue collecting these items? This program will examine how we might define our legacy and preserve and pass on family treasures to future generations. Discussion will cover how to organize, preserve, share, or let go of family papers and possessions. Kathy’s presentation will help us to avoid the overwhelm.

Kathy Nielsen is a librarian, historian and storyteller. She has hosted a virtual monthly program, All Things Relative, at the Monterey Public Library. Kathy is the co-founder of the Monterey County Genealogical Society’s special interest writing group, Off the Charts. She is currently a popular genealogy speaker on the Monterey Peninsula, and has been featured on Lisa Louise Cooke’s weekly YouTube program, Elevenses.
